⚠️ Section 2: The Truth About Indian Driving Conditions
🇮🇳 Driving in India is NOT like driving in Europe or the US.
Here’s why you need more than 15 days:
🔸 Traffic is unpredictable
You share roads with:
Bikers weaving through gaps Autos stopping anywhere Pedestrians walking mid-lane Street dogs or cows crossing Truck drivers cutting lanes Cyclists without rear view awareness
🔸 Lanes, Signs & Signals? Often Ignored
Faded or missing lane markings Turn signals rarely used Roundabouts with no logic Overtaking from left is common Wrong-side driving even in cities
🔸 Mental Pressure Is Higher
Unlike structured foreign roads, here your brain is constantly:
Scanning 6+ directions Calculating gap distances Watching for signals AND sudden stops Managing honks and pressure from behind

📊 Section 4: What 15-Day Programs Actually Cover
Day Range
Training Focus
What’s Missing
Days 1–3
Basic controls: clutch, brake, gear
Mirror habits, turning technique
Days 4–6
Forward movement, slight turns
Spatial judgment, fear control
Days 7–9
U-turns, gear shifts in light traffic
Panic drills, real-time traffic pressure
Days 10–12
Straight roads, basic reverse
Real parking, highway merging, solo trials
Days 13–15
RTO test path rehearsals
Emotion control, rain/night/fog drive, confidence
🛑 Most learners come out technically capable but mentally unsure.

🎓 Section 7: What a Complete Driving Journey Should Look Like
✅ Phase 1: Foundation (Week 1–2)
Understanding the car Mirror + gear control Turning logic, spacing, footwork
✅ Phase 2: Traffic Exposure (Week 3)
Entering junctions Lane management in real roads Adapting to public chaos
✅ Phase 3: Emotion Control (Week 4)
Mindset coaching Panic prevention Night & rain orientation
✅ Phase 4: Practice + Parking (Week 5)
Reverse in real basements Parallel parking Navigating society exits, malls, tight roads
✅ Phase 5: Solo Runs & Test Prep (Week 6)
Dry runs without instructor RTO mock test Final confidence building
🎯 Real driving confidence is built in phases. Not rushed through checklists.
🌍 Section 8: Challenges Unique to Indian Cities
City
Road Challenges
Surat
Roundabouts, flyovers, multiple signal logic
Mumbai
Peak-hour pressure, multi-lane discipline, parking chaos
Jaipur
Overconfidence from wide roads, sudden unmarked turns
Pune
Hilly zones, college traffic, fast turns
Bangalore
Rain, tech zone crowds, parking in tight basements
Delhi
Aggressive cut-ins, ring roads, wrong-side driving spots
A 15-day course can’t prepare you for city-specific behavior. That requires adaptive coaching, not a cookie-cutter routine.
